To program the DVD player's remote control to operate your TV, follow these steps:

  1. Turn on the TV, and then aim the DVD player’s remote control at the TV.
  2. Press and hold the [TV Power] button on the DVD player's remote control.
  3. While holding the [TV Power] button, use the number buttons on the remote to enter the two digit code assigned to your brand of TV.
Note 1: If your DVD player's remote control can be programmed to operate a TV, the TV brand codes will be listed in your owner's manual. If you don't have your owner's manual available, click here to go to the download center and download a copy.
Note 2: Many TV brands have more than one code. If the first code does not work, try the next available code.
  1. If the TV turns off, the code worked correctly and your remote control is now programmed. If the TV stays on, repeat steps 1 through 3 with a different code listed for your brand of TV.
Note: If none of the codes listed allows your DVD player's remote to control your TV, then the remote is not compatible with your specific model.

I get set 3 when i press the remote and nothing else no matter what i press play etc any suggestions

Try reprogramming the remote so it matches the unit. If you get SET 3 or DVD 3 on the display, chances are the remote's command code is different to the unit, in which case the following may help a bit:

Ensuring new batteries are in the remote, correctly polarised ( + and - ) and with the remote pointed at the unit (while unit is on), press and hold both the [3] and [ENTER/OK] buttons TOGETHER for 5 - 10 seconds, then release. The remote should now fully control the unit.

If it doesn't, check the batteries and repeat the above. The above procedure is a suggestion based on Panasonic DVD recorders and their operation troubleshooting manuals. Give it a try at least.

My panasonic dvd recorder / remote control is not working On pressing button on remote I get dvd2 on recorder screen but no other response. I have tried reset without effect

Try reprogramming the remote itself; i.e. point remote at unit (while on), press and hold the [2] and [ENTER/OK] buttons together for 5 - 10 seconds, then release. The remote's command should now match that of the unit (DVD 2) (the unit should now recognise the remote). Failing that, remove batteries from remote, replace with new ones (just in case) and repeat the above suggestion. You should not need to reset the main unit.

Whenever the batteries are replaced in Panasonic remotes, in some cases, a remote command reprogram is often required to ensure that the remote commands the unit fully and correctly. You may find this procedure outlined in your instruction manual. Hope this helps a tad.

I entered,in error, Command mode 3 on the set up and now the remote control won't operate the machine.The display keeps showing DVD 1,how do I restore things?

Try this (works for Panasonic) - remove the batteries from the remote (as if to replace them with new ones), press any button on it to clear its buffer, then re-insert them (if they are reasonably fresh). Point remote at unit, press 1 and ENTER/OK buttons together - hold for 10 seconds, then release. This should restrore the command back from remote to the unit, and it should now fully operate. Just something to try, it may work.

Many Panasonic DVD recorders operate on the same principle; there are 3 remote command mode settings (default is DVD1) - so it's very easy to make errors in setup, but just as easy to correct.

My Blu ray player keeps flashing an "RC-1" error anytime a button is pressed on the remote.

Remote command mode is different to the unit. Try resetting the remote by doing the following;

While unit is on, but no discs loaded or playing, remove the batteries from the remote (as if you were replacing them), press any button on the remote to clear its buffer, then, if the batteries you removed are OK, re-insert them. Point remote at the player, press and hold 1 and ENTER/OK buttons together for 10 seconds, then release. This should restore your remote's command to the original default mode, and it should control the player fully.

Panasonic and some SONY units operate on this principle with remote command modes (these differ between models). RC1 / DVD1 / SET1 is usually the default.

Sony remote RM-DX500 not working with Disc Explorer 400 DVP-CX985V, but does work with tv. How can I program it to work the dvd player?

There are 2 set's of command switch's for the dvd player, a 3 position command switch on the back side of the dvd player and another 3 position command switch on the inside of the remote right next to the batteries, easiest option is to remove batteries from remote and test each one of the 3 position switch's labeled 1,2 & 3 and test remote control.
